Firefighter 2

Firefighter II is the final step for interior structural firefighters, based on NFPA 1001 (Firefighter Level II) performance objectives. The course covers incident command, building collapse, vehicle extrication, technical rescue, hose testing, foam operations, flammable materials, fire detection and alarms, fire cause analysis, communications, reporting, pre-fire planning, and tactical strategy.

Must be Firefighter 1 certified.

Must bring full PPE, SCBA, and spare bottle.

OSHA 29 CFR 1910.156 Seminar

This evening seminar will provide fire service personnel with an overview of OSHA 29 CFR 1910.156 and the proposed updates that may impact fire department operations, training, safety, and compliance. Attendees will review key portions of the current standard, examine major proposed changes, and discuss how those changes could affect departmental policies, staffing, medical requirements, and training expectations.

Rapid Intervention Team (RIT)

This course trains firefighters to form and operate an effective RIT. Blending classroom theory with hands-on exercises, it covers essential rescue operations including team organization, deployment, communication, and safe fireground tactics. Emphasis is placed on rapid, coordinated responses to assist firefighters in distress while ensuring overall incident safety.

Must have Firefighter 1.

Must have full PPE, SCBA, and spare bottle.

Vehicle Extrication Awareness and Operations

This course teaches vehicle rescue techniques including vehicle/machine classification, extrication, stabilization, patient disentanglement and care, Incident Command System operations, and incident termination. The course emphasizes hands-on skills.

Must have full PPE and eye protection.

Emergency Vehicle Operations Course (EVOC)

This course is a combination classroom and practical skills training focused on emergency vehicle operations. Topics include safety, legal aspects, inspection, and driver responsibilities. Both written and practical examinations are administered. This class meets WV State Fire Commission driver training requirements and recommendations.

It is recommended that you bring apparatus from your own department to drive.

Fire Investigation Level 1

This course is designed to give initial responders the knowledge and ability to recognize the signs of an intentionally set fire. This knowledge guides responders in evidence preservation and notification of appropriate officials. This course covers the basic topics of: Fire behavior, critical observations on scene, fire cause, scene security, evidence preservation, legal considerations, and proper reporting procedures.

Fire Investigation Level 2

This course provides responders with more advanced skills in determining fire origin and cause. Students will strengthen their understanding of fire dynamics, scene examination, and investigation procedures. Emphasis is placed on documentation, evidence handling, interview techniques, and coordination with investigators. Topics include fire pattern analysis, origin determination, evidence collection, witness interviews, scene reconstruction, legal considerations, and courtroom testimony.

Vehicle Extrication Technician

This course is designed to train responders to safely extricate victims from passenger vehicles, focusing on stabilizing the vehicle, creating access/egress, and removing patients using tools, following NFPA standards for incidents on wheels, sides, or roofs, and emphasizing rescuer/patient safety. This role involves scene size-up, hazard mitigation, and advanced problem-solving with various equipment.

Must be Vehicle Extrication Operations certified.

Must have full PPE and eye protection.
